Abstract

The degree of swelling of caustobioliths in liquids depends on their character. Correspondingly, the molecular weight MC of hydrocarbon chain segments between the crosslink sites, which is determined based on the Flory-Rehner or Kovac equations, changes. Based on the generalization of data on the swelling of Turkish lignites from the Goynuk deposit, it was found that the determined values of MC depend on the physicochemical characteristics of solvents in a complicated manner. Therefore, the values of MC determined in unsolvating hydrocarbons should be considered the most reliable.
